Output 28f58cb9e522663da0187371456cc98a49ec4da3757ceb360f9927d2cdc111cb:85

value
109127
script pubkey
OP_0 OP_PUSHBYTES_32 626f59c3d8492cb06b27d6e3b8d030476272f18d8c31d54b4eceddd12424efa8
address
bc1qvfh4ns7cfyktq6e86m3m35psga389uvd3sca2j6wemwazfpya75qsrp5aa
transaction
28f58cb9e522663da0187371456cc98a49ec4da3757ceb360f9927d2cdc111cb
spent
true